Geographic Location of Neknanpur


The village Neknanpur is located in Chandur Railway Tahsil of Amravati District in the State of Maharashtra in India. It comes under Chandur Railway Community Development Block. The nearest town is Chandur, which is about 5 kilometers away from Neknanpur.

Social Structure of Neknanpur


As per available data from the year 2009, 185 persons live in 50 house holds in the village Neknanpur. There are 96 female individuals and 89 male individuals in the village. Females constitute 51.89% and males constitute 48.11% of the total population.

There are 38 scheduled castes persons of which 19 are females and 19 are males. Females constitute 50% and males constitute 50% of the scheduled castes population. Scheduled castes constitute 20.54% of the total population.

There are 39 scheduled tribes persons of which 21 are females and 18 are males. Females constitute 53.85% and males constitute 46.15% of the scheduled tribes population. Scheduled tribes constitute 21.08% of the total population.

Population density of Neknanpur is 67.17 persons per square kilometer.

Land and Natural Resources in Neknanpur

Total area of Neknanpur is 275.42 Hectares as per the data available for the year 2009.

Total sown/agricultural area is 234.68 ha. About 15.28 ha is un-irrigated area. About 219.4 ha is irrigated area. About 15.28 ha is irrigated by wells/tube wells.

About 12.77 ha is in non-agricultural use. About 7.53 ha is used permanent pastures and grazing lands. About 4.45 ha is under miscellaneous tree crops.

About 0.81 ha is lying as current fallow area. About 5.56 ha is culturable waste land. About 3.2 ha is lying as fallow land other than current fallows. About 6.42 ha is covered by barren and un-cultivable land.
